Outline of Final Research Achievements |
In order to understand the nuclear matter equation of state (EOS), especially the isospin asymmetry term, so-called "symmetry energy", we have established the method to directly determine the nucleon density distributions and the neutron skin thicknesses because the symmetry energy is known to have strong correlation with the neutron skin thicknesses of double magic nuclei. We have also extended this experimental method to unstable nuclei, finally have successfully measured proton elastic scattering of 132Sn in inverse kinematics. In addition, we have developed new methods to investigate the EOS with the systematic change of density distributions, or alpha-clustering in medium-heavy nucleus.
